Output e3bc8368ad1c381a2f2d63be38a0517cb90ace152e85b3acd49c9358d9dab822:278

value
156096
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 05f3857870aadb7bdddefb5962eaeab781cef4cac7ca88d1d36d3b8d82a814b3
address
bc1pqhec27rs4tdhhhw7ldvk96h2k7quaax2cl9g35wnd5acmq4gzjesdcqj3r
transaction
e3bc8368ad1c381a2f2d63be38a0517cb90ace152e85b3acd49c9358d9dab822
spent
true